public ActionResult DeleteConfirmed(int id) { OilPress oilPress = db.OilPresses.Find(id); db.OilPresses.Remove(oilPress); db.SaveChanges(); return(RedirectToAction("Index")); }
public ActionResult Edit([Bind(Include = "OilPressID,OilPressName,OliveType,OlivesWeight,OilOutput,ProductionDate,UserId,FactoryID")] OilPress oilPress) { if (ModelState.IsValid) { db.Entry(oilPress).State = EntityState.Modified; db.SaveChanges(); return(RedirectToAction("Index")); } //ViewBag.UserId = new SelectList(oilPressesQuery, "UserId", "LastName", selectedOilPress); return(View(oilPress)); }
// GET: OilPresses/Details/5 public ActionResult Details(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} OilPress oilPress = db.OilPresses.Find(id); if (oilPress == null) { return(HttpNotFound()); } return(View(oilPress)); }
// GET: OilPresses/Edit/5 public ActionResult Edit(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} OilPress oilPress = db.OilPresses.Find(id); if (oilPress == null) { return(HttpNotFound()); } PopulateOilPressesDropDownList(oilPress.UserId); PopulateFactoriesDropDownList(oilPress.FactoryID); return(View(oilPress)); }
public ActionResult Create([Bind(Include = "OilPressID,OilPressName,OliveType,OlivesWeight,OilOutput,ProductionDate,UserId,FactoryID")] OilPress oilPress) { try { if (ModelState.IsValid) { db.OilPresses.Add(oilPress); db.SaveChanges(); return(RedirectToAction("Index")); } } catch (Exception) { ModelState.AddModelError(" ", "Unable to save changes"); } PopulateOilPressesDropDownList(); PopulateFactoriesDropDownList(); return(View(oilPress)); }